Iran opens airspace to Qatar planes amid Saudi-led ban

TEHRAN, July 1 (Xinhua) -- Iran has opened its airspace to the passenger planes of Qatar over the past days, Tasnim news agency reported on Saturday.

Iran's Supreme National Security Council (SNSC) has issued the permission for the flights over the Islamic republic space as they are banned from Saudi, Egyptian and UAE airspaces after a diplomatic row between Qatar and the Arab countries.

Qoliollah Qolizadeh, a member of the presiding board of the parliament's civil commission, told Tasnim that the Qatari authorities coordinated the issue with Iran's Foreign Ministry and got the required permissions from the SNSC.

Some Arab allies of Saudi Arabia recently closed their airspace to the Qatari planes after they cut diplomatic ties with the country, accusing the latter of supporting terrorism.
